Anyont out there know the flow rate and output pressure of the old underhood belt drive pumps? Got a wierd idea cooking in the back of my mind.:D
According to my trusty Owner's Manual here it should be 1400 - 1700 PSI. Doesn't say what the flow rate should be, but maybe they still have a mechanic's guide posted at their web site for the belt drive systems that could be checked?

Dear Chris,
Look for 1500 psi and 3.5 gallons per minuet maximum
for the pump
specifications and it will be what the winch needs to
work well. If it has
to much, a trip to the local hydraulic shop will be
needed to adjust it.
Charlie, Milemarker.
